Joshua Davis 1931 - 2000

Joshua Davis of Natchez, Adams County, MS was born on May 19, 1931, and died at age 69 years old on July 1, 2000. Joshua Davis was buried at Natchez National Cemetery Section D Site 447A 41 Cemetery Road, in Natchez.

Did you know?
In 1931, in the year that Joshua Davis was born, in March, “The Star Spangled Banner” officially became the national anthem by congressional resolution. Other songs had previously been used - among them, "My Country, 'Tis of Thee", "God Bless America", and "America the Beautiful". There was fierce debate about making "The Star Spangled Banner" the national anthem - Southerners and veterans organizations supported it, pacifists and educators opposed it.
